Hi Varun, On 2026-08-18 at 22:42:41 +0530, Varun Gupta wrote: > Parameterize test_prefetch_fault() to accept a shader getter function > pointer instead of hardcoding get_prefetch_shader(). This enables reuse > of the same test logic with different shader configurations (e.g., L2 > prefetch fault shaders) without duplicating the test function. > > No functional change for existing subtests. > > Signed-off-by: Varun Gupta <[email protected]> Did you changed anything here from v1? If not, then r-b from Priyanka should be added. No need for sending series again, it could be applied at merge time.
